Job Description:
Education:
Required: Bachelor's Degree or higher level degree in Physical Therapy (PT)
Preferred: Master's degree or Doctorate degree in PT
Licensure/Certification:
Required: Licensed by the PT Board of the State of California; American Heart Association BLS
Experience:
Preferred: Physical therapy or healthcare experience
Job Objective: Implements treatment plans and selects modalities to meet specific established goals. Provides prescribed physical therapy (PT) treatment to facilitate the rehabilitation of mentally or physically handicapped patients. Assists in the evaluation of patient progress and recommends discharge planning. Conducts and assists with patient activities and maintains appropriate records.
Essential Responsibilities:
Demonstrates compliance with Code of Conduct and compliance policies, and takes action to resolve compliance questions or concerns and report suspected violations.
Performs evaluation and established treatment plans based on age specific, cultural, and rehabilitative needs and in compliance of hospital licensing and accreditation standards and in compliance with the Physical Therapy Practice Act.
Provides effective therapy treatments.
Consistently and appropriately delegates patient treatment procedures and modalities.
Provides safe and comprehensive discharge planning.
Individual productivity meets department standards.
Provides thorough, timely, legible, and consistent patient care documentation.
Utilizes all resources to assist with patient flow as applicable (prints forms, schedules patients, etc.).
Provides effective education and mentoring for student interns as assigned.
Participates in special department programs.
Facilitates interdisciplinary communication and coordination to maximize patient outcomes.
Communicates positively, appropriately, and in a timely fashion to all communications including patients, co-workers, supervisors, other departments, physicians, etc..
Maintains equipment supplies and treatment areas.
Essential Skils:
Ability to prioritize tasks and manage time efficiently to meet deadlines
Knowledge, skills, and ability to administer all department modalities, programs, and protocols appropriate to the age of the patients served
Basic Physical Therapy Skills
Ability to communicate with patients, healthcare professionals, and staff to ensure clear and accurate exchange of information
Written and verbal communication skills
